Summary of Prioritized Risks and Recommendations

Key Risks Identified:

  1. Climate (85% Likelihood, Critical Severity, RHC Score: 4.5)
  • Climate change affects temperature, precipitation, and extreme weather events, leading to unpredictable yield fluctuations.
  1. Pest Infestations (75% Likelihood, High Severity, RHC Score: 4.0)
  • Pests such as corn borers and armyworms can significantly damage crops, especially with rising temperatures increasing pest lifecycles.
  1. Soil Erosion (65% Likelihood, Moderate Severity, RHC Score: 3.5)
  • Loss of topsoil leads to reduced fertility and increased dependency on fertilizers, raising costs and sustainability concerns.
  1. Market Volatility (70% Likelihood, High Severity, RHC Score: 3.8)
  • Fluctuations in commodity prices and input costs (e.g., fertilizers, fuel) impact profitability.
  1. Supply Chain (60% Likelihood, Moderate Severity, RHC Score: 3.2)
  • Disruptions in transportation, labor shortages, and input supply delays can affect production and distribution.

Recommendations for Risk Reduction:

  1. Climate Adaptation Strategies:
  • Implement drought-resistant and heat-tolerant hybrid corn varieties.
  • Utilize precision agriculture technologies to optimize water and nutrient management.
  1. Pest Control Measures:
  • Employ Integrated Pest Management (IPM) techniques, such as biological pest control and crop rotation.
  • Monitor pest populations and apply targeted treatments instead of broad-spectrum insecticides.
  1. Soil Conservation Practices:
  • Promote no-till or reduced tillage farming to prevent erosion.
  • Use cover crops to improve soil health and reduce erosion risks.
  1. Market Risk Management:
  • Diversify crop production to hedge against price fluctuations.
  • Utilize futures contracts and crop insurance to mitigate financial losses.
  1. Strengthening Supply Chains:
  • Develop local and regional sourcing alternatives to reduce dependency on global suppliers.
  • Enhance storage infrastructure to minimize post-harvest losses.

By implementing these risk management strategies, corn producers can improve resilience and maintain profitability despite the uncertainties in production and market conditions.
